Rahul Gandhi to visit Odisha in February last week

Bhubaneswar: With the general elections fast approaching, Congress is leaving no stone unturned to strengthen the party’s base in the State.

After visiting Odisha twice in a span of 12 days, All India Congress Committee (AICC) President Rahul Gandhi is again scheduled to visit the State in the last week of February. He will attend a public rally in Bargarh. This will be his first visit to the Bargarh district as Congress president.

Speaking to mediapersons, Odisha Pradesh Congress Committee (OPCC) President Niranjan Patnaik said, “Rahul Gandhi will visit Bargarh in the last week this month. However, the date is yet to be finalized. Tentatively, he may come between February 26 and 28.”

This will be Rahul’s second visit to the State in February. Earlier on February 6, the Congress National President attended two public meetings at Bhawanipatna in Koraput district and Rourkela in Sundergarh district.
